Key Responsibilities

Junior AI Engineers are primarily responsible for assisting in the development and maintenance of AI models. Duties include collecting and preprocessing data, implementing algorithms under supervision, conducting experiments to optimize model performance, and reporting findings.

Collaboration with cross-functional teams to translate business requirements into technical specifications is essential, as well as participating in code reviews and improving existing AI methodologies.

Key Skills

Successful Junior AI Engineers should possess a basic understanding of machine learning concepts, programming languages such as Python or R, and data manipulation tools like Pandas or NumPy. Familiarity with libraries like TensorFlow or PyTorch, alongside an aptitude for problem-solving and analytical thinking, will greatly benefit candidates.

Good communication skills are also vital for effectively conveying complex ideas to non-technical stakeholders.

Qualifications

Typically, a bachelor’s degree in computer science, data science, or a related field is required for Junior AI Engineers. Relevant internships or coursework in artificial intelligence or machine learning can enhance a candidate's profile.

Certifications from recognized platforms can also set you apart in the job market, showing your commitment and foundational knowledge in AI.

Career Progression

A Junior AI Engineer role is often a stepping stone towards more advanced positions, such as AI Engineer or Data Scientist. With experience and continued learning, you can progress to specialized roles focused on areas like deep learning, natural language processing, or computer vision.

Continuous education and participation in projects will enhance your expertise, making you a strong candidate for future opportunities.
